python

python的gcd函数的参数有哪些限制

小樊
82
2024-09-10 15:31:53
栏目: 编程语言

Python的内置函数math.gcd()用于计算两个整数的最大公约数(greatest common divisor,GCD)。该函数接受两个参数,这两个参数都应该是整数。

参数限制如下:

  1. 参数必须是整数。如果传入非整数类型的参数,将会引发TypeError
  2. 参数不能为负数。如果传入负数,将会引发ValueError

以下是一个使用math.gcd()函数的示例:

import math

a = 56
b = 98

result = math.gcd(a, b)
print(f"The GCD of {a} and {b} is {result}")

输出结果:

The GCD of 56 and 98 is 14

0
看了该问题的人还看了